Transaction fd0e82e1371bb49e28bd79e39b03280f1659c95517df9c89cbb968cc16f11f93

36 Input
1 Outputs
  • fd0e82e1371bb49e28bd79e39b03280f1659c95517df9c89cbb968cc16f11f93:0
  • value  4492605407
    address  3JjPf13Rd8g6WAyvg8yiPnrsdjJt1NP4FC